#39ba63 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#39ba63 is composed of 22.4% red, 72.9% green and 38.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 69.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 46.8% yellow and 27.1% black. It has a hue angle of 139.5 degrees, a saturation of 53.1% and a lightness of 47.6%. #39ba63 color hex could be obtained by blending #72ffc6 with #007500. Closest websafe color is: #33cc66.

Shades and Tints of #39ba63
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020603 is the darkest color, while #f6fcf8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#39ba63
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#718277 is the less saturated color, while #01f24f is the most saturated one.
